Do You Really Need a Nominee Director within the UK for Your Enterprise?
Starting a enterprise in the United Kingdom offers quite a few advantages, including a powerful legal framework, international credibility, and access to international markets. Nonetheless, one query that always arises for entrepreneurs, particularly non-residents, is whether or not they need a nominee director for their UK company.
Understanding the position of a nominee director and whether or not it is necessary may help you make informed choices when structuring your business.
What Is a Nominee Director?
A nominee director is an individual appointed to act because the official director of an organization on behalf of the particular owner. While their name seems in public records, they typically would not have control over the corporate’s each day operations. Instead, they act according to the instructions of the useful owner, typically through a formal agreement.
Nominee services are commonly used for privateness, compliance, or administrative purposes.
Is It Mandatory to Have a Nominee Director in the UK?
The easy reply is no. UK firm law doesn't require you to appoint a nominee director. You'll be able to register and operate a company in the UK as a director, even if you are not a UK resident.
There are minimal restrictions when forming a UK limited company. You want not less than one director who's a natural individual and at least sixteen years old. That director might be you, regardless of your country of residence.
When Would possibly You Consider a Nominee Director?
Though not required, there are particular situations the place appointing a nominee director is likely to be beneficial.
One frequent reason is privacy. Within the UK, firm directors’ particulars are publicly available through Companies House. In the event you prefer to keep your name off public records, a nominee director can provide a layer of confidentiality.
Another reason could be perceived credibility. Some enterprise owners consider that having a UK-primarily based director might enhance trust with local partners, banks, or clients. While this shouldn't be always needed, it can sometimes make certain processes smoother.
Additionally, if you're unfamiliar with UK laws, a nominee director with local knowledge might enable you navigate compliance requirements more easily. Nevertheless, this depends heavily on the arrangement and the level of involvement agreed upon.
Risks and Considerations
Utilizing a nominee director shouldn't be without risks. Legally, the nominee director is liable for the corporate’s compliance with UK laws. This implies that if anything goes incorrect, they can be held accountable.
For the beneficial owner, there may be additionally a level of trust involved. You're essentially inserting another person in an official position within your company. Without a transparent legal agreement, this may lead to disputes or lack of control.
It's also essential to understand that nominee arrangements should be transparent and lawful. The UK has strict regulations regarding useful ownership and anti-money laundering. You are still required to declare the individual with significant control over the company.
Alternatives to a Nominee Director
In lots of cases, appointing yourself because the director is the simplest and most cost-efficient option. This provides you full control and eliminates the need for third-party involvement.
If privacy is your fundamental concern, there are other strategies to protect your personal information, similar to using a registered office address service instead of your home address.
You may also hire professional accountants or firm formation agents to handle compliance and administrative tasks without giving up directorship.
Making the Proper Resolution
Deciding whether or not to use a nominee director depends in your specific business goals, risk tolerance, and wish for privacy. For many entrepreneurs, especially those running small or on-line businesses, a nominee director is not necessary.
Carefully weigh the benefits towards the potential risks. For those who select to use a nominee service, ensure that you work with a reputable provider and have a strong legal agreement in place.
Understanding your obligations and sustaining control over your company should always remain a top priority when doing enterprise within the UK.
